Arcure Revenue
Arcure had revenue of 7.51M EUR in the half year ending June 30, 2025, a decrease of -17.64%.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to 17.28M, down -22.86% year-over-year. In the year 2024, Arcure had annual revenue of 21.06M with 4.02% growth.

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
